Fiddle Workshop 1
Maurice Manley’s Polka
A very popular session tune which is great for applying ‘pulse bowing’ and practicing your polka groove. It has also been selected as a great introduction to playing chords on the fiddle – the shapes to use and some effective rhythms to apply. Suitable for players from competent beginners to upper intermediates. Full worksheets will be provided, with the tune, bowing and ornamentation, along with audio files of the tune, in advance. Fiddle Workshop 2
The Barrowburn (A. Harper)
A stonking reel in D major that lends itself well to the Georgia Shuffle bowing pattern. It has also been selected as a great introduction to playing chords on the fiddle – the shapes to use and some effective rhythms to apply. Aimed at intermediate to advanced level fiddle players. Full worksheets will be provided, with the tune, bowing and ornamentation, along with audio files of the tune, in advance. Saint Cuthbert Crossing the Rhine (Chris Ormston)
In this afternoon workshop we’ll look at a personal favourite from one of North East England’s finest tunesmith’s, the legendary piper Chris Ormston. Saint Cuthbert Crossing the Rhine is a terrific, punchy Northumbrian rant containing some wonderful hidden syncopation.
